Ditch #5 and #9, nigglers are bad! The Claw vermin I'd keep but look to rehire once you have the cash. Play a game or two with journeymen then when you have enough money buy the two missing Gutters. Once you have that save for another Vermin and replace #2. Voila, megateam! That ST4 Gutter is enough to win games on his own, especially at low TV.

I'd also be very tempted to drop the Rat Ogre until your team is complete with positionals again, if you even rehire him at all. I know some people love the big guy but he's not really worth his weight these days.
